Zoom!® Advanced Power™ Teeth Whitening
Coffee, tea, red wine, tobacco, and other substances can leave our pearly whites stained and discolored. Fortunately, the latest teeth whitening systems offer a safe and effective way to restore the dazzling smile. Bleaching systems remove harsh stains and brighten the natural pigmentation of the teeth, resulting in a radiant smile. Dr. Atencio is proud to feature the Zoom!® Advanced Power™ teeth whitening system, one of the fastest bleaching treatments on the market.
During the whitening session, a hydrogen peroxide gel is applied to the teeth and activated by a light. The process allows patients to achieve a smile that is eight to ten shades brighter in just one hour. We also offer at-home teeth bleaching kits, which can lighten teeth by up to three shades in just a few days. Dental Implants
Tooth loss can be both physically and emotionally devastating. Missing teeth not only affect the way a person talks and eats, but can also affect his or her self-confidence. Fortunately, patients who are missing teeth as a result of periodontal disease, injury, or other condition have a new reason to smile, thanks to dental implant technology. Dental implants are sturdy metal posts that are embedded in the jaw and topped with artificial teeth that look, feel, and perform like natural teeth.
During the dental implant procedure, a titanium post is surgically placed into the jawbone. After the bone and surrounding tissue heals, a beautiful replacement tooth is attached to the top of the post, resulting in a smile that is flawless and fully-functional. Full and Partial Dentures
Patients who are missing teeth but are not ideal candidates for dental implants can still attain a stunning smile with full or partial dentures. Dentures are custom-designed artificial teeth that are attached to a connective device made of plastic and metal. They are a durable, comfortable, and natural-looking way to enhance your smile and maintain facial structure, and can be removed from the mouth for easy cleaning. Patients who are missing just a few of their teeth can take advantage of partial dentures, which are held in place by small clasps connected to surrounding teeth and gums. For patients who are missing all of their teeth, our practice can also create full dentures. Full dentures fit over the gums and are held in place by strong muscles in the mouth.
Porcelain Dental Crowns
Tooth imperfections such as chips, cracks, or stains can have a dramatic impact on the appearance of a smile. Porcelain dental crowns are a great way to mask those flaws. A porcelain crown is a natural-colored cap that fits snugly over the damaged tooth to provide functional support and eliminate pain and discomfort. There are two stages during treatment. During the first visit, the damaged tooth is cleaned and an impression is made. The impression is then sent to a lab where the permanent crown is crafted. Dr. Atencio places a temporary crown over the tooth until the next visit when the custom-designed permanent crown can be put in place. Porcelain Veneers
Like porcelain crowns, porcelain veneers are an exceptional way to hide dental imperfections such as chips, cracks, stains, or misalignment. Veneers are thin, translucent porcelain shells that are bonded to the front of teeth to shape and create a straight and luminous smile. Porcelain veneers can be fitted and placed in two office visits. During the first visit, the front surfaces of the teeth are buffed and a thin layer of enamel is removed to make room for the added thickness of the veneers. Next, an impression is taken of the teeth so the veneers can be custom designed for appropriate fit. Finally, during the second office visit, the veneers are bonded to the teeth, resulting in a remarkably smile. Dental Bonding
Dental bonding is used to sculpt teeth and cover up flaws. An alternative to dental crowns and veneers, dental bonding can be completed quickly since the procedure does not involve creating an impression and sending it to the lab for restoration design. During the dental bonding process, a composite resin is applied to the surface of the damaged tooth and sculpted to restore its natural shape and appearance. Dental Bridges
Tooth loss can leave gaps in the mouth that make it difficult to talk and eat. Fortunately, Dr. Atencio can restore missing teeth with a natural-looking dental bridge. A dental bridge is made up of two crowns and an artificial tooth that “bridges” the gap between existing teeth. The crowns are placed over the teeth adjacent to the gap in order to hold the artificial tooth in place.
During the procedure, an impression is made of the teeth on either side of the gap to create crowns. Once the crowns are made, an artificial tooth is bonded between them. Finally, the dental bridge is placed in the mouth and the crowns are cemented over the neighboring teeth, resulting in a full smile. Tooth-colored Fillings
For decades, dentists used silver and amalgam fillings to restore damaged teeth, which left a tell-tale sign of dental work. Today, patients no longer have to deal with the appearance of a metallic smile. Dr. Atencio offers natural-looking fillings as a more aesthetically-pleasing alternative to their metallic counterparts. Tooth-colored composite fillings are virtually unnoticeable and are much more effective than metal fillings because they bond to the tooth and help prevent breakage. They are also safer since they do not contain mercury like traditional fillings. Dr. Atencio can even exchange old metallic fillings with new tooth-colored replacements for a flawless smile. Inlays and Onlays
Inlays and onlays are longer-lasting alternatives to dental fillings for patients with cavities. Like fillings, inlays and onlays fill in areas where decay has been removed from the teeth. However, inlays and onlays are shaped in a lab before being cemented into place, whereas fillings are molded directly into the tooth. Inlays are placed inside the cusps of a tooth whereas onlays cover multiple cusps on a tooth to build up a damaged area. Onlays may be needed in situations where considerable reconstruction is necessary.

Endodontic Treatment
Patients suffering from severe tooth pain or a deep cavity may have an infection at the center of the damaged tooth. If the infection is not treated, an abscess can form and the tooth may need to be extracted. To prevent this, Dr. Atencio can perform an endodontic root canal treatment to save and strengthen a tooth that is badly decayed or infected. During root canal treatment, the root canals inside the tooth are cleaned and the infected area is removed. The tooth is then filled with a composite material and capped with a filling or crown.

Tooth Extraction
Tooth extraction may be required for a number of reasons. For example, patients suffering from severe tooth damage, infection, or decay may need to have one or more teeth removed. Sometimes a patient’s mouth may be too small to accommodate all of their teeth, resulting in a misaligned smile and uncomfortable bite. In order to correct the problem, some teeth may need to be extracted. In other cases, patients may need to have wisdom teeth pulled if there is not enough room in the mouth to comfortably contain them.
